Side by side
| Factor | Uber | Train |
|---|---|---|
| Option | Taxi (GO/DiDi app or Regular) | Meitetsu μ Sky Limited Express |
| Cost | ~¥18,600 | ¥1,230 |
| Journey | 76 min to Nagoya Station | 28 min to Meitetsu Nagoya |
| Wait | On-demand or short wait | Frequent (every 15-30 min) |
| Payment | Card & Cash | Card & Cash |

Scams to watch either way
- Taxi Overcharging
Unscrupulous taxi drivers may demand inflated fares from unaware tourists, especially for airport transfers.
Avoid: Always confirm the metered fare or use official ride-hailing apps (GO, DiDi, Uber) with upfront pricing.
- Fake Ride-Hailing
Individuals may impersonate ride-hailing drivers, offering rides at exorbitant prices or with no intention of using the app.
Avoid: Only book rides through official apps and verify the driver and vehicle details before entering.
